Consciousness is the most immediate reality we know, yet it remains one of the deepest mysteries we face. From everyday moments of awareness to philosophical puzzles, consciousness is the terrain that science, philosophy, and even mysticism seek to explore and explain. In this season opener, Kate invites you to stand at the edge of a vast intellectual landscape, where every path offers a radically different map of the mind, and questions that feel intimately personal can shake the very foundations of reality.

Through this guided tour, Kate charts the major theories of consciousness, from materialist and physical to idealist and mystical, highlighting why no single explanation has unified the field and what’s at stake in how we choose to understand ourselves. Listeners will discover the big questions that drive the season and prepare to explore the implications of every answer, from artificial intelligence to life’s meaning and the possibility of surviving death.

Today on Mind Shift:

·       Season three launches with a bold project: mapping the full spectrum of consciousness theories.

·       Introduction to Robert Lawrence Kuhn's taxonomy, a landscape that organizes every major theory not by correctness, but by character and implications.

·       Why Nobel laureates, renowned neuroscientists, physicists, and philosophers profoundly disagree on the fundamental nature of consciousness.

·       Exploration of the spectrum: materialist theories, idealist views, quantum and information approaches, panpsychism, monism, and dualism.

·       The four core questions that shape the season: meaning, AI consciousness, mind uploading, and survival after death.
